.Felix Pinkston.Oct 29, 2024 08:15.Discover exactly how BNB Chronicle, built on BNB Greenfield, deals with data storage problems on the BNB Chain through making sure lasting information schedule in a decentralized manner. The BNB Establishment community has offered the BNB Annals, a data older post level created to resolve the problem of boundless condition development on the Binance Smart Establishment (BSC). The BNB Chronicle, built on BNB Greenfield, aims to provide long-lasting data accessibility while sustaining trustlessness and decentralization, according to the BNB Chain Blogging Site.Addressing Total Node Storage Space Obstacles.Operating a complete nodule on the BNB Chain has actually become progressively resource-intensive as a result of the developing storing needs.
The BNB Smart Chain Yearly Storage Report 2024 highlights that the total storage space size of a BSC full nodule has hit 2.45 TiB, along with block data eating most of the storage space. The sizable block size requires keeping all blocks from the genesis block to the absolute most latest, leading to considerable disk space utilization.To attack this, BNB Chronicle uses a solution through offering a decentralized and permissionless concern user interface for historic block information. This method lessens the storage space requirements of a nodule through excluding historic records, lining up with propositions like EIP4444 and BEP283, which aim to optimize storing consumption.Making Certain Lasting Data Supply.BNB Annals permanently retail stores historic block and blob data throughout the Greenfield network, ensuring the data’s immutability and protection to reduction.
This storing service is actually crucial for the long-term data availability of coating 2 rollups, specifically with the intro of BEP336, which targets to lower costs for Layer 2 rollups by delivering specialized blob space for rollup information. Nonetheless, BEP336 will certainly throw out blob data much older than 18 days, producing the BNB Chronicle’s job in keeping historical information a lot more important.Unit Design.The BNB Annals features three primary parts: the Block/Blob Indexer, the API Web Server, and also Sunlight Peers. The Block/Blob Indexer continuously marks blocks and also balls from the blockchain and retail stores them in Greenfield, making sure no block is skipped.
The API Server manages ask for historical records, while Light Peers work as a blockchain customer backed through Greenfield storage, capable of working within the P2P network.Data honesty is actually made sure by means of a post-verification procedure that confirms all uploaded blocks against stashed records in Greenfield, identifying any overlooking records. This architecture maximizes storage space use as well as assurances data ease of access.Relative Review.The BNB Chronicle is compared to similar networks in the Ethereum ecosystem, including the Site System and EthStorage, relating to decentralization, support for historic state inquiries, as well as records gain access to latency. While BNB Annals masters supporting block as well as ball questions, it currently does not have a reward system, unlike EthStorage.Future Expectation.Appearing in advance, BNB Chronicle aims to introduce a reward mechanism to enrich decentralization and also cover storage space prices.
This operation could possibly include taking advantage of BNB Establishment’s unit reward deal to finance storage on the Greenfield system, bring in even more data uploaders as well as maintainers.In addition, innovations in blockchain innovation, like the world state storing version in Erigon v3, present possibilities to grow BNB Annals’s functionalities to consist of historic condition data, improving it in to a comprehensive global archive nodule.In General, BNB Annals stands for a considerable advance in guaranteeing the BNB Establishment’s information accessibility and also safety, placing it as a crucial infrastructure component for the blockchain’s future growth as well as sustainability.Image source: Shutterstock.